Quoin lands $104.5M as rare skin drug child study expands

Quoin Pharmaceuticals announced a private placement of up to $104.5 million, securing orphan and Fast Track designations for its lead drug QRX003, which is aimed at treating Netherton Syndrome. The company also expanded its pediatric study for Netherton Syndrome to seven patients and anticipates initiating Phase 3 and releasing topline data in the second half of 2026. Despite widening net losses in 2025, Quoin's year-end cash balance of $18.7 million is expected to fund operations into 2027.

FDA clears Quoin Pharmaceuticals’ QRX003 IND for Phase II PSS trial

Quoin Pharmaceuticals said the FDA cleared its IND for QRX003 to start a Phase II trial for Peeling Skin Syndrome. The study is expected to begin in 2H 2026, enrolling 6 to 8 patients in the US and Europe. Patients will apply the topical lotion twice daily to over 80% of body surface for 52 weeks. Quoin targets approval in 2028.

Quoin Files IND For QRX003 To FDA In Treatment Of Peeling Skin Syndrome

Quoin Pharmaceuticals said it filed an IND with the FDA for QRX003 to treat Peeling Skin Syndrome, based on results from an ongoing investigator-led pediatric study. The company expects to start a Phase 2 trial in the second half of 2026 after FDA review. It reported improvements in skin, sleep and quality of life, and said QRX003 was well tolerated.
